826 Seattle
826 Seattle is a nonprofit writing and tutoring center dedicated to helping young people improve their creative and expository writing skills, and to helping teachers inspire their students to write. Our services are structured around our belief that great leaps in learning can happen with one-on-one attention and that strong writing skills are fundamental to future success. All programs at 826 Seattle are free of charge.

In November 2011, 826 Seattle was honored with a 2011 National Arts and Humanities Youth Program Award. The National Arts and Humanities Youth Program Award is the nation's highest honor for after-school arts and humanities programs. This award recognizes and supports outstanding programs that lay new pathways to creativity, expression, and achievement outside of the regular school day.
